    Bonus: Show Creator Bruce Miller

    Play Episode Listen Later Jun 26, 2017 61:16


    Handmaid's Tale creator Bruce Miller has worked in TV for years, but this show presented a singular challenge. “Usually the books you adapt stink,” he says. “This is a great book. So you really want to capture that feeling, that greatness, on TV. ... I was you. I didn't want to see the ruined version of this either.” We got to speak to Miller about the show this week, for a special bonus episode of The Red Center. He talks about working with Margaret Atwood, where the show will go in season 2, and the joys of writing profanity. We also ask him if Jeannine is really dead, to mixed success.     Episode 10: How does it end?

    Play Episode Listen Later Jun 14, 2017 67:29


    Shows are often crunched for time in season-ending episodes, and The Handmaid's Tale is no exception. Its creators managed to pack a lot into the hour, and though Gilead persists, it's clear that season 2 won't be strapped for material. Rose and Laura talk, however, about how the source material of Margaret Atwood's book is indeed exhausted by the finale, in some unexpected ways. How does it end? We can't really say.     Episode 9: Who needs to chill?

    Play Episode Listen Later Jun 7, 2017 54:18


    The ninth episode of The Handmaid's Tale, “The Bridge,” shows us women on the edge. Janine literally so, but other women more metaphorically: June, Moira, Serena Joy, and even the Waterfords' housekeeper seem ready to revolt. The cracks in the Gileadan system are now clear to everyone — not just the handmaids. Rose and Laura are left to wonder: is Aunt Lydia the only clear-cut villain of Gilead?     Episode 7: How does a gun work?

    Play Episode Listen Later May 24, 2017 56:29


    It's no exaggeration to call episode 7 of the Hulu series The Handmaid's Tale a “game changer.” The episode steers almost completely clear of its novel source material, choosing instead to build a whole other world. It also answers some pressing questions about Gilead, about what remains of the US, and about what became of one of June's family members: Luke.
